A Vibrant Landmark on U.S. 301
Travelers driving along U.S. 301 through King George County, Virginia, are likely to encounter a striking new sight. A bright, eye-catching sign featuring a prominent arching rainbow stands out against the roadside landscape, officially announcing the presence of Gardening Gays Farm. The colorful display serves as a welcoming and highly visible beacon for both local residents and commuters passing through the area.
